The Problem

A homeowner in Chesapeake Beach, MD (20732) discovered water in their finished basement after a heavy rain event. The sump pump had failed silently β€” it had stopped working at some point before the storm, and the homeowner had no way of knowing until water appeared.

The basement had approximately 2 inches of water throughout, affecting flooring, drywall, and stored belongings. The pump was 11 years old and had never been tested or serviced.

The Diagnosis

We removed the failed pump and inspected it. The float switch had seized in the down position β€” the pump motor was functional, but the float switch that triggers it had failed, so the pump never activated when water entered the pit.

The pump itself was also showing signs of wear consistent with its age. Given the float switch failure and the pump's age, replacement was the appropriate recommendation rather than a float switch repair on an aging pump.

We also noted that the discharge line had a check valve that was functioning correctly β€” the failure was entirely in the float switch.

The Solution

We installed a new 1/2 HP submersible sump pump with a reliable vertical float switch. We also installed a battery backup sump pump system β€” a critical addition for a home in Chesapeake Beach, where proximity to the Bay means power outages during storms are common.

The battery backup system activates automatically when the primary pump fails or when power is lost. It provides approximately 8 hours of pumping capacity on a full charge.

We tested both systems thoroughly before leaving β€” filling the pit to confirm both the primary pump and the battery backup activated correctly at the proper water levels.

The Outcome

The homeowner has had no water intrusion events since the installation, including during two significant rain events. The battery backup system has activated once during a brief power outage, performing exactly as designed.

Key Takeaways

  • Sump pump failures are often silent β€” the pump stops working before you know it
  • Test your sump pump twice a year by pouring water into the pit
  • Battery backup systems are essential for homes near the Chesapeake Bay
  • A pump more than 7–8 years old should be proactively replaced
  • Float switch failure is one of the most common sump pump failure modes
